The only poker room that I am aware of that does not require an application download is PokerRoom.com

Does anyone know of any others?

A couple of reasons for preferring applet-based rather than application-based sites are [1] usable from non-Windows platforms (mac, linux, etc.), and [2] privacy/security (Java applets run in a restricted sand-box so cannot access other files and data on the computer nor can they easily compromise the system's security).
